I have a 30-page hybrid horror/comedy prose story and I want it living on the page as a fully formatted screenplay. Every slug line, action line, character cue, and parenthetical should follow standard screenplay convention (Courier 12 pt, 1.5” left margin, 1” right, proper tab stops).
Your task is to translate the narrative into visual, scene-driven language while protecting the mix of scares and laughs that makes the piece work. Where prose lingers on inner thoughts, convert them into cinematic moments, punchy dialogue, or clear action. Feel free to suggest lean structural tweaks so that the script flows in a classic three-act rhythm, but do not add new plot threads.
